Code : 1FFZ   PDBj   RCSB PDB   PDBe
Header : RIBOSOME
Title : LARGE RIBOSOMAL SUBUNIT COMPLEXED WITH R(CC)-DA-PUROMYCIN
Release Data : 2000-08-28
Compound :
mol_id molecule chains
1 23S RIBOSOMAL RNA A
fragment: DOMAIN V OF 23S RIBOSOMAL RNA
other_details: PART OF THE 50S LARGE RIBOSOMAL SUBUNIT
mol_id molecule chains
2 R(P*CP*C*)-D(P*A)-R(P*(PU)) B
other_details: AN ANALOG OF A-SITE AMINOACYL-TRNA AND P-SITE PEPTIDYL-TRNA AS THEY ARE COVALENTLY LINKED BY THE TETRAHEDRAL CARBONYL CARBON INTERMEDIATE IN PEPTIDE BOND FORMATION. CONTAINS PU, PUROMYCIN-N-AMINOPHOSPHONIC ACID
Source :
mol_id organism_scientific
1 Haloarcula marismortui  (taxid:2238)
other_details: CULTURED CELLS
mol_id organism_scientific
2
synthetic: yes
Authors : Nissen, P., Hansen, J., Ban, N., Moore, P.B., Steitz, T.A.
Keywords : ribosome assembly, RNA-RNA complex, Ribozyme, ribosomal RNA, ribosome
Exp. method : X-RAY DIFFRACTION ( 3.2 Å )
Citation :

The structural basis of ribosome activity in peptide bond synthesis.

Nissen, P.,Hansen, J.,Ban, N.  et al.
(2000)  Science  289 : 920 - 930

PubMed: 10937990
DOI: 10.1126/science.289.5481.920
